Plantae - Anthophyta - Dicotyledoneae - Scrophulariales - Orobanchaceae - Orobanche - Hitchcock and Cronquist (1974) noted that Heckard had been recently annotating specimens from Washington and southern British Columbia with this name for a new taxon; Heckard described Orobanche corymbosa ssp. mutabilis in 1978 (with a Washington type locality). Heckard and Chuang (1975) noted that further cytogeographic survey was needed to determine whether the taller, spicate plants of the Columbia Plateau in Washington (with 2n = 48 from Kittitas and Grant counties) were uniformly different in chromosome number from the shorter, corymbose plants of the Great Basin region (with 2n = 96 from Nevada and California). The type locality for Orobanche corymbosa ssp. corymbosa is in southwestern Idaho (Owyhee County) (Ferris 1960; Cronquist et al. 1984), on the southern portion of the Columbia Plateau (e.g. Hunt 1967).
